I just turned out my first end grain board using some blackwood off cuts and some Huon pine. It's 300x400x35 and weighs about 2.5kg. It took me a week to make and I'm feeling like I won't be making another one until I've had a rest from making this one!

Got some pretty nice grain pattern in there. Much debate in my head about the pros and cons of going to 220grit or not. Concerned about closing the grain structure so oil might not penetrate.
